2 definitions by Merriam-webbster

DPS (Donkey Punch Syndrome) is an illness that can be sexually transmitted and/or passed on by someone whom is carrying DPS. DPS is someone whom acts retarded-like and says/does things out of the ordinary.
Man, this guy seems to scare women away for no reason. He must have DPS.
by Merriam-webbster May 9, 2017
Get the DPS mug.
A man who does exactly what the wife/girlfriend asks without question.
Danny T would like to hang out with his friends at bars and parties, but his wife/girlfriend says he is not allowed to hang out without her supervision. Danny T is a mandilon.
by Merriam-webbster November 12, 2015
Get the Mandilon mug.